Babar Azam wins ICC ODI Cricketer of the Year award
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

DUBAI: Pakistan’s star batter and all-format captain Babar Azam stamped his authority as the world cricket’s best One-Day International player by winning the ICC ODI Cricketer of the Year award on Monday. The announcement was made by the ICC on its website.

Babar had a phenomenal year with the bat as he scored 405 runs in only six matches at a staggering average of 67.50. He was key to Pakistan’s away series win over South Africa in the ODIs where he was named the Player of the Match in both games that Pakistan won.

He thanked the fans, the PCB and the ICC for supporting and backing him. According to the ace batsman, his innings of 158 against England at Birmingham was the best knock he has ever played as he was struggling and the innings gave a much-needed boost to his confidence.
